Forum: PC-Programmierung Raspberry Bluetooth


von Steffen B. (Gast)


Lesenswert?

Hallo zusammen,

ich möchte zwischen einem Smartphone / Tablet und einem RPi eine 
Bluetoothverbindung herstellen.

Das RPi soll ausschließlich Daten senden, die ich möglichst einfach auf 
dem Smartphone haben möchte. Da das RPi ohne Display mobil eingesetzt 
wird, soll eine Verbindung nur mit dem Smartphone hergestellt werden.

Ich stelle mir das so vor, dass ich mit dem Smartphone das RPi per 
Bluetooth finde, kopple und dann eine serielle Verbindung habe, mit der 
ich die Daten empfangen kann.

Habt ihr ein Stichwort, wie ich das Pairing ohne Eingabe am RPi handeln 
kann? Wg. Sicherheit gibt es keine Probleme.

VG Steffen

von Philipp H. (anobit)


Lesenswert?

Wenn du die Bluez-utils und bluez-tools packages installierst, und 
deinen Bluetooth-Dongle zum laufen bringst ist das alles kein Problem.

Per se nimmt die Bibliothek "SSP" also "Secure Simple Pairing". Dabei 
ist keine Eingabe auf dem Raspberry nötig. Am tablet musst du je nach 
einstellung in deiner hci.conf (irgendwo unter /etc/bluez..) auch nichts 
mehr tun.

Wenn du bei deinem Dongle den "PISCAN" modus beim ersten pairen 
aktivierst, bist du da schon fertig. Das sorgt dafür, dass der RasPi vom 
Tablet gefunden werden kann. Wie du das machst, kannst du google 
entnehmen.

Bzgl. serieller kommunikation: Stichwort ist "RfComm".

Falls du damit doch Probleme hast, poste deine Ausgabe des tools 
"hciconfig".
Dann kann dir mehr geholfen werden.

Grüße,
AnoBit

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.